summ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orYukihiro "Matz" Matsumoto <[email protected]>2014-02-12 09:28:12 +0900
committerYukihiro "Matz" Matsumoto <[email protected]>2014-02-12 09:28:12 +0900
commit67d63387ee941601ae42d379bbccadb176ccd513 (patch)
tree8e5b85601a296d03fa123a91a1db1a41af5a6f5b
parent8e78db3af3ff5d12fa84b6a4d70482efbb3a091a (diff)
parent8a3a3a5a49e86f855d01a6fa7ee5b39f3fb22c60 (diff)
downloadmruby-67d63387ee941601ae42d379bbccadb176ccd513.tar.gz
mruby-67d63387ee941601ae42d379bbccadb176ccd513.zip
Merge pull request #1695 from cremno/clang-and-icl-define-direct-threaded
Clang and ICC/ICL: define DIRECT_THREADED
-rw-r--r--src/vm.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/vm.c b/src/vm.c
index 2901f89d9..52510c98d 100644
--- a/src/vm.c
+++ b/src/vm.c
@@ -527,7 +527,7 @@ argnum_error(mrb_state *mrb, int num)
#define CODE_FETCH_HOOK(mrb, irep, pc, regs)
#endif
-#ifdef __GNUC__
+#if defined __GNUC__ || defined __clang__ || defined __INTEL_COMPILER
#define DIRECT_THREADED
#endif